I own a 1990 GTZ. I'm sure that means something to all of you. but for some reason, that means nothing to anyone at autozone or napa. My belt tensioner FLEW off my engine while I was doing about 70mph, after I pulled away from the toll booth. I did not know what I heard under the hood until I got home and saw my serpentine belt was laying in the undercarraige. I then also noticed a hefty spring, which to me, looked pretty important. Upon further inspection, I was surprised to see the tensioner had flown off its mount. Auto zone was quick to find a replacement. It was not the right part. After much digging and frustration, I found a used one inside of a Cutlass at a junk yard! Where can I find a NEW ONE? :crazy:

GM number is 24575670. Probably expensive.

rockauto.com has four or five choices.
